Symptoms

  • •Vibration felt in the steering wheel or seat at speeds over 60 mph
  • •Uneven tire wear or visible tire damage
  • •Steering wheel shake or pull to one side
  • •Noise accompanying vibration (humming or grinding)
  • •Vehicle feels unstable or difficult to control at high speeds

Solution
1. Tire Inspection and Adjustment
  • Sub-steps:
    • Inspect each tire for uneven wear or bulges.
    • Ensure all tires are inflated to the manufacturer-recommended pressure.
    • Replace any damaged or excessively worn tires.
2. Wheel Balancing
  • Sub-steps:
    • Remove the wheel from the vehicle using a socket set.
    • Mount the wheel on a wheel balancer.
    • Adjust the weight on the rim as needed to achieve balance.
    • Reinstall the wheel and torque to manufacturer specifications (usually 76-84 ft-lbs for Toyota Corolla).
3. Suspension Check
  • Sub-steps:
    • Visually inspect shocks, struts, and bushings for signs of wear or leaks.
    • Replace any compromised components.
    • Check for play in control arms and tie rods; replace as necessary.
4. Wheel Alignment
  • Sub-steps:
    • Use an alignment machine to check and adjust camber, toe, and caster angles.
    • Adjust settings according to manufacturer specifications for the Corolla.
5. Drivetrain Component Inspection
  • Sub-steps:
    • Inspect CV joints and driveshaft for any signs of wear or damage.
    • Replace any worn components.
